“THE AIR MAIL.”
On Saturday, the Maorilaud Theatre auuounces, they will screen a wonderful realistic picture by p&r-amaunt of the mail services ol America, showing in detail the dangers that beset the pioneers of aviation who undertake to- deliver the mails to time. “The Air Mail” has a very dramatic story and is most exciting. Thrilling and sensational incidents are seen in every foot of the film. Several'of the scenes show thrilling air fights and pursuit of air bandits, who are after the treasure contained in the air mails. The cast includes Douglas* Fairbanks, Jurrr., Warner Baxter and Billie Dorset. The cast and production is unequalled and the story maintains its hold on patrons until the last foot.
